On Wed, Jan 26, 2022 at 11:53:04AM -0800, Manasi Navare wrote:
> With some VRR panels, user can turn VRR ON/OFF on the fly from the panel 
> settings.
> When VRR is turned OFF ,sends a long HPD to the driver clearing the Ignore 
> MSA bit
> in the DPCD. Currently the driver parses that onevery HPD but fails to reset
> the corresponding VRR Capable Connector property.
> Hence the userspace still sees this as VRR Capable panel which is incorrect.
> 
> Fix this by explicitly resetting the connector property.
> 
> v2: Reset vrr capable if status == connector_disconnected
> v3: Use i915 and use bool vrr_capable (Jani Nikula)
